1 # $NetBSD: Makefile,v 1.25 2009/12/13 08:03:44 mrg Exp $ 2 3 .include <bsd.own.mk> 4 5 .if ${OBJECT_FMT} == "ELF" && exists(${CSU_MACHINE_ARCH}_elf) 6 SUBDIR= ${CSU_MACHINE_ARCH}_elf 7 .elif ${OBJECT_FMT} == "ELF" && exists(${MACHINE_ARCH}_elf) 8 SUBDIR= ${MACHINE_ARCH}_elf 9 .elif ${OBJECT_FMT} == "ELF" && exists(${MACHINE_CPU}_elf) 10 SUBDIR= ${MACHINE_CPU}_elf 11 .elif exists(${MACHINE_ARCH}) 12 SUBDIR= ${MACHINE_ARCH} 13 .elif exists(${MACHINE_CPU}) 14 SUBDIR= ${MACHINE_CPU} 15 .else 16 .BEGIN: 17 @echo no SUBDIR for ${MACHINE_ARCH}_elf, ${MACHINE_ARCH} nor \ 18 ${MACHINE_CPU} 19 @false 20 .endif 21 22 .if (${OBJECT_FMT} != "ELF") 23 SUBDIR+= c++ 24 .endif 25 26 .include <bsd.subdir.mk> 27